Subject: Key rotation — Murdock Garage Occupancy Feed

Dear plugin authors,

As part of our quarterly security cycle, the credentials for the Carillon occupancy feed serving the Murdock Deck garages will rotate this Friday at 09:00. Old keys stop working immediately after cutover; cached readings will continue for ten minutes. Please update your integrations with the new key provided here.

service key, fawip-bajef: kto11_Qt5wZK9vdNC

## Dependency Pinning Policy: Limits and Quotas

All services in the Fernvale monorepo pin direct dependencies exactly; transitive ranges are resolved weekly by the lockbot. Exceptions require a maintainer note in the manifest. Unpinned packages fail CI. Quotas govern how many pins may update per cycle, and those ceilings are defined here.

tuning table, yajog-yahof:
BUDGETS = {
    "lamvan": 303,
    "wenox": 460,
    "fenvan": 525,
}

## Tuning

The Splitfern assignment service decides which experiment bucket each visitor lands in. Most support tickets about "wrong variant" trace back to cache staleness or hash seed rotation, not assignment bugs. Before escalating, check that the client honors the assignment TTL and sticky-session window. The relevant constants are listed below.

tuning table, kajog-kawef:
PRIORITIES = {
    "kelox": 870,
    "kasix": 89,
    "eliax": 988,
}

Test plan: intermittent DNS failures in Quillbay batch jobs

For the release manager: jobs fail ~2% of runs with resolution timeouts against the internal resolver. Plan: pin resolver in the job image, add retry with jitter, rerun the nightly suite 50x. Results post to the metrics endpoint, which requires bearer auth; the staging token is below.

bearer token for kagap-fawef: eyJhbGciOiJIUzI1NiIsInR5cCI6IkpXVCJ9.eyJzdWIiOiIcaYGydIn0.boChePUA

## Deployment — Stridegate chip reader

The Stridegate reader service ingests timing-chip pings at each mat and forwards splits to the results board. Deploy it on the trackside unit before race morning and confirm the antenna health check passes twice. Support staff should not modify mat mappings mid-race. On startup, the service loads the following configuration values.

settings of tagef-bawif:
DRUIX_HOST=druix.zemvarlabs.internal
DRUIX_PORT=8000